Putin didn't return. Putin has left nowhere since 1999. Actually, there was no doubt about who would win the last election. There aren't other candidates among people who have participated the election. The really strong rivals were not approved for elections. We see the same composition every time since 2000. With the same result. People support Putin because of strong conversation with West, joining of Crimea, powerful army and new nuclear weapon. Russian TV explains us about unfriendly partners around Russia, foreign agents inside and only Putin could defend us. However, many people are afraid of the situation in Ukraine and believe only Putin could prevent such situation in Russia. These are the reasons why people have been voting for Putin. Maybe some people have voted for Putin because of they are forced or afraid of losing his job, but the vast majority of people really likes Putin.
I haven't gone to vote anyway.
